Two Canadian soldiers killed in Afghanistan
Updated Sun. Jan. 6 2008 11:19 PM ET
CTV.ca News Staff
Two Canadian soldiers were killed Sunday when their armoured vehicle rolled over in rough terrain near Kandahar City.
Military officials said the incident was "unrelated to enemy fire."
The soldiers have not been identified.
CTV's Murray Oliver, reporting from Kandahar Airfield early Monday morning, said the accident happened 40 kilometres southwest of the city.
The deaths come one week after a roadside bomb blast claimed the life of Gunner Jonathan Dion, 27, as he travelled to Kandahar Airfield for New Year's Eve.
He was a member of the 5th Regiment d'Artillerie legere du Canada, which is based in Valcartier, Que.
Four other soldiers were injured in the attack.
Canada has 2,500 soldiers operating in southern Afghanistan as part of the NATO mission.
Since military operations began in 2002, 76 military personnel and one diplomat have died in the country.
